Jurnal Teknologi dan Informatika (JEDA)
Jurnal Teknologi dan Informatika (JEDA) adalah jurnal ilmiah yang bertujuan untuk menginformasikan hasil penelitian dibidang ilmu komputer yang diharapkan dapat membantu para dosen dan mahasiswa dalam mempublikasikan hasil penelitian terkait dengan Teknologi Informasi dan Teknologi Informatika dan kajian ilmiah lainnya kepada berbagai komunitas ilmiah diseluruh Indonesia. Focus dan Scope Jurnal Sistem Pakar. Sistem Penunjang Keputusan. Data Mining. Sistem Kecerdasan Buatan. Jaringan Komputer. Teknik Komputer. Pengolahan Citra. Algoritma Genetik. Business Intelligence and Knowledge Management. Sistem Database. Big Data. Enterprise Computing. Technology Management. Robotik. Internet of Things

IMPLEMENTASI METODE CERTAINTY FACTOR PADA SISTEM PAKAR DIAGNOSA PENYAKIT AYAM BROILER
Yuli Syafitri
Jurnal Teknologi dan Informatika (JEDA) Vol 1, No 1 (2020): APRIL 2020
Publisher : Universitas Mitra Indonesia
Show Abstract
|
Download Original
|
Original Source
|
Check in Google Scholar
|
DOI: 10.57084/jeda.v1i1.962
AbstractExpert system to diagnose diseases in web-based broiler chickens was built based on the problems of society in general who are still very unfamiliar with the disease and solutions that occur in broiler chickens. Expert system (Expert System) in general is a system that seeks to adopt human knowledge to computers, so that computers can solve problems as is usually done by experts. This expert system uses the Forward Chaining technique with the Certainty Factor method. Data collection methods in the form of literature studies, observations, interviews, literature review and browsing. In the planning of the system described in the form of DAD level 0, then derived DAD level 1. This expert system in diagnosing diseases in web-based broiler chickens supports two users, namely admin and general user. Admin can enter, change and delete symptoms, input news. General users can only consult based on the symptoms experienced by their Broiler chickens and find information about Broiler chicken diseases. The purpose of this thesis is to create a health consultation service via the internet or on-line.
